使用 python 将 graphviz 源保存到点文件
save graphviz source to dot file using python
我正在 python 中使用 graphviz 编写可视化。我导入了 graphviz 和 pylab。我想出了如何保存图示
import graphviz as gv
import pylab
g1 = gv.Graph(format='png')
g1.node('A')
g1.node('B')
g1.edge('A', 'B')
g1.view()
print(g1.source)
filename = g1.render(filename='img/g1')
pylab.savefig('filename.png')
如何将源文件保存到 .dot 文件?
当您使用 g1.render(filename='img/g1')
时,它会将源转储到 img/g1
。
用文本编辑器打开即可。
如果要命名,使用g1.render(filename='g1.dot')
。
我正在 python 中使用 graphviz 编写可视化。我导入了 graphviz 和 pylab。我想出了如何保存图示
import graphviz as gv
import pylab
g1 = gv.Graph(format='png')
g1.node('A')
g1.node('B')
g1.edge('A', 'B')
g1.view()
print(g1.source)
filename = g1.render(filename='img/g1')
pylab.savefig('filename.png')
如何将源文件保存到 .dot 文件?
当您使用 g1.render(filename='img/g1')
时,它会将源转储到 img/g1
。
用文本编辑器打开即可。
如果要命名,使用g1.render(filename='g1.dot')
。